Ingenjörskonst bakom AI-agenter som verkligen håller måttet
När AI-agenter blir riktiga ingenjörer
Det verkliga problemet med AI-utveckling
De flesta pratar om hur snabbt AI kan skriva kod. Men det är inte där utmaningen ligger. Det stora problemet är att få systemen att fatta bra arkitekturbeslut, hantera oväntade situationer och skapa kod som håller över tid – inte bara just nu.
Det är här agentisk utveckling kommer in. Målet är inte att ersätta utvecklare, utan att bygga AI som faktiskt tänker som erfarna ingenjörer.
Vad skiljer en bra agent från en vanlig kodgenerator?
Vanliga verktyg fungerar som en maskin: du matar in en specifikation och får kod tillbaka. En agentisk approach är något helt annat. Den kan:
- Göra upprepade beslut istället för att leverera en enda lösning
- Granska sitt eget arbete mot projektets regler
- Förstå sammanhang som ligger utanför den ursprungliga instruktionen
- Ta till sig feedback under arbetets gång
- Väga avvägningar mellan prestanda, underhåll och säkerhet
Skillnaden är att en kodgenerator bara producerar text. En bra agent motiverar sina val.
Varför Microsofts projekt är intressant
Microsofts AI-Engineering-Coach-projekt handlar om hur man bygger in ingenjörsmässighet i AI-system. Det handlar inte om längre prompts eller fler parametrar – det handlar om hur systemet är konstruerat.
Här är några principer som spelar roll för alla som bygger AI-baserad infrastruktur:
1. Kontexthantering
En agent behöver förstå hela projektet – inte bara den fil som redigeras. Det handlar om beroenden, deployment-mönster, teamets konventioner och prestandakrav. De flesta AI-verktyg missar detta och optimerar lokalt utan att se helheten.
2. Validering i loopar
Riktiga ingenjörer testar sitt arbete. Agenter bör göra samma sak. Genom att bygga in tester, linting och simulerad kodgranskning minskar risken att hallucinationer blir till teknisk skuld.
3. Motivera sina beslut
När en agent väljer en lösning ska den kunna förklara varför. Det handlar inte bara om tillit – det gör det också möjligt att förbättra systemet över tid.
4. Förstå begränsningar
Ingenjörsarbete handlar om att lösa problem inom givna ramar: budget, legacy-system, säkerhetspolicyer och teamets kompetens. En agent som ignorerar dessa ramar levererar lösningar som ser bra ut men inte fungerar i praktiken.
Tillämpning: AI för hosting och infrastruktur
På NameOcean tittar vi på hur agentisk utveckling kan användas i Vibe Hosting – vår AI-drivna infrastrukturplattform. Frågan är hur en agent kan fatta beslut kring DNS, SSL och skalning som känns relevanta för just den användaren.
En bra agent bör förstå trafikmönster, affärsmodell och kunna förklara avvägningar mellan kostnad, prestanda och tillförlitlighet. Det kräver att ingenjörsmässighet är inbyggd i systemet från början.
Praktiska lärdomar
Om du bygger eller använder AI-agenter i dina projekt, tänk på följande:
- Definiera begränsningar först. Säkerhet, prestanda och teamstandarder ska styra vad agenten får göra – inte tvärtom.
- Bygg in validering. AI-förslag ska granskas, inte accepteras rakt av.
- Dokumentera resonemang. Det gör det lättare att hitta fel och förbättra systemet.
- Justera både prompts och begränsningar tillsammans. Det ger bäst resultat.
Framtiden för agentisk utveckling
Microsofts projekt pekar mot en framtid där AI inte bara skriver kod snabbare – utan också gör smartare val. Det kräver att vi höjer ribban för vad som räknas som en bra agent.
Det handlar inte om att generera mer kod. Det handlar om att fatta bättre beslut, med förståelse för sammanhanget – inte bara prompten.
De agenter som kommer att göra verklig skillnad är de som är tränade att tänka som ingenjörer, inte bara som skrivmaskiner.
Nyfiken på AI-stödd infrastruktur? Kolla in NameOcean’s Vibe Hosting – där vår agent hjälper dig fatta bättre beslut kring domäner, DNS och molnresurser.